London to Shanghai, am I eligible for the 72 hour visa?

Hi there. I'm flying from London to Shanghai via Paris and staying in Shanghai for less than 48 hours. I have an onward plane ticket from Shanghai to Taipei. Thanks.

Answers (1)
Answered by Sherry from Philippines | Apr. 08, 2015 03:10
00Reply
Yes, you are eligible for it.
